What is the role of accounting firm? |
what is the role of accounting firm Accounting firms are some of the original outsources of business. If I own a store and things get hopping, which is easier to hire some new sales people or hire another bookkeeper. Hiring a firm to keep or check the books is an expense that does not pose a problem with benefits, employment taxes, worker's comp insurance, etc. Besides, the accounting firm will have a better quality of staff than the local store will want, or be able, to hire. Then there are taxes. There are also the temptations to be managerially-creative with the accounts--to which the accounting firm, as opposed to the store's employee, will be able to correctly scoff and say, "That's bull s--t, go somewhere else if you want to play those games." Accounting firms sometimes specialize. One may be employed to do the payroll, another for taxes, and still another to audit things to make sure that the whole set of books is reasonably proper. If I had an enormous store chain and hired the best of the available accountants to do things myself, the business would probably be incorporated and so I would still need to hire an accounting firm to verify (audit) for the government and stockholders that my books and taxes are reasonably correct.
